Improving services at Groves hospital

Groves Mem­orial Community Hospital Anaesthesia and Ob­stetrics Groups are now offering round-the-clock anaesthetic and epidural services for women in labour.

The new service is possible due to the recent recruitment of two family doctors with anaesthesia training.

In the last year, Groves has upgraded its newborn equipment, renovated and expanded one of the two labour rooms, and many of the post-partum beds are now private rooms permitting partners to room-in with mom and newborns.
